Why Visit Snæfellsnes Peninsula
Snæfellsnes Peninsula is often referred to as “Iceland in Miniature” because it encapsulates the diverse beauty of the entire country within its scenic stretch. From majestic glaciers and rugged cliffs to picturesque fishing villages and serene beaches, this destination offers a perfect blend of nature and culture. Best Things to Do in Snæfellsnes Peninsula
1. **Kirkjufell Mountain**: This iconic mountain is one of the most photographed in Iceland. Its distinctive shape and surrounding waterfalls make it a must-visit for photographers and nature lovers alike.
2. **Snæfellsjökull National Park**: Home to the famous Snæfellsjökull glacier, this park offers hiking trails, volcanic landscapes, and stunning coastal views. It's a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ts.

3. **Arnarstapi and Hellnar**: Explore the charming fishing villages of Arnarstapi and Hellnar. The coastal walk between them features stunning rock formations and birdlife, making it a perfect spot for a leisurely stroll.
4. **Djúpalónssandur Beach**: Known for its black pebbles and dramatic cliffs, this beach is a great place to relax and take in the raw beauty of Iceland's coastline.

Best Time to Visit
The best time to visit Snæfellsnes Peninsula is during the summer months (June to August) when the weather is mild, and days are long. However, if you are interested in seeing the Northern Lights, consider visiting during the winter months (October to March).
Travel Tips
- Dress in layers; the weather can change quickly. - Always respect nature and wildlife. - Check road conditions, especially in winter. - Consider booking tours in advance to secure your spot.
